**Introduction**
Inconel 625 is a high-performance nickel-based alloy that is renowned for its exceptional strength, corrosion resistance, and heat tolerance. This superalloy is widely used in the aerospace, chemical processing, and manufacturing industries due to its superior properties. In this article, we will explore the power of Inconel 625 forgings and how they are transforming the manufacturing landscape.
**The Advantages of Inconel 625 Forgings**
Inconel 625 forgings offer a myriad of benefits that make them ideal for demanding industrial applications. These forgings exhibit excellent resistance to corrosion, oxidation, and high temperatures, making them suitable for harsh environments. Additionally, Inconel 625 forgings have superior mechanical properties, including high tensile strength and fatigue resistance, ensuring longevity and reliability in critical components.
**Applications of Inconel 625 Forgings**
The versatility of Inconel 625 forgings makes them indispensable in various industries. From gas turbine components and chemical processing equipment to marine engineering and nuclear reactors, Inconel 625 forgings play a vital role in ensuring the safety and performance of critical systems. The ability of Inconel 625 forgings to withstand extreme conditions makes them a preferred choice for high-stress applications.
